1. Product Overview
The LINGBAO M5 Series Gaming Mouse offers high-performance features for esports and PC gaming. Available in several versions (M5, M5 Pro, M5 Pro Max, M5 Max+), these mice feature tri-mode connectivity (2.4GHz wireless, Bluetooth, wired), advanced optical sensors (PAW3311 or PAW3395), and up to 8K polling rate for ultra-smooth and responsive operation.

3. Setup Guide
3.1. Charging the Mouse
The LINGBAO M5 Series mice are rechargeable. Connect the mouse to a power source using the provided USB Type-C cable. For models with a charging base, place the mouse onto the magnetic charging base. The charging base itself connects via a Type-C port.

3.2. Connecting the Mouse
The LINGBAO M5 Series supports three connection modes: 2.4GHz Wireless, Bluetooth, and Wired.
- 2.4GHz Wireless Mode:
- Locate the 2.4G receiver (for M5/M5 Pro, it's a USB dongle; for M5 Pro Max/Max+, it's integrated into the charging base).
- Plug the 2.4G receiver into an available USB port on your computer.
- Turn on the mouse using the power switch on the bottom. Switch the mode toggle to '2.4G' or 'OFF' (if 'OFF' is the 2.4G mode for your specific model).
- The mouse should automatically connect.
- Bluetooth Mode:
- Turn on the mouse and switch the mode toggle to 'BT' (Bluetooth).
- On your computer or device, go to Bluetooth settings and search for new devices.
- Select 'LINGBAO M5' or similar from the list of available devices to pair.
- The Bluetooth indicator on the mouse will confirm connection.
- Wired Mode:
- Connect the mouse directly to your computer using the provided USB Type-C cable.
- The mouse will function as a wired mouse and charge simultaneously.

4. Operating Instructions
4.1. DPI Adjustment
The mouse features a DPI adjust button, typically located on the top or bottom of the mouse. Press this button to cycle through different DPI settings. The DPI indicator (if present) will show the current level. Some models allow six-speed adjustable DPI.
For M5 Pro Max/Max+ versions, the DPI range is 400-26000dpi. For M5/M5 Pro, it's 800-12000dpi or 400-26000dpi depending on the sensor.
4.2. Polling Rate
The M5 Series mice support various polling rates, with some models offering up to 8K (8000Hz) polling rate for silky-smooth operation and minimal latency. This provides fine positioning, high throughput, high concurrency, and anti-interference capabilities.

6. Troubleshooting
6.1. Connection Issues
- Mouse not responding: Ensure the mouse is turned on and the correct connection mode (2.4G/BT/Wired) is selected. Check battery level.
- 2.4GHz connection unstable: Ensure the receiver is plugged in securely and is close to the mouse. Avoid interference from other wireless devices.
- Bluetooth pairing failed: Make sure the mouse is in Bluetooth pairing mode and your device's Bluetooth is enabled and discoverable. Try re-pairing.
6.2. Performance Issues (e.g., 8K Polling Rate)
To ensure optimal performance, especially when using the 8K polling rate, your computer configuration should meet the recommended specifications:

| Component | Intel Platform | AMD Platform |
|---|---|---|
| CPU | i79700K and above | Ruilong 3700X and above |
| Graphics | NVIDIA RTX2060 and above | AMDRX5700XT and above |
| Memory | 16GB and above | 16GB and above |
| Display: screen refresh rate above 240Hz | ||
If your system is below these requirements, the polling rate setting can be reduced for a better experience.
7. Specifications

| Feature | M5 | M5PRO | M5PRO MAX | M5 MAX+ |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Main Control IC | BK3633 | BK3633 | Isaki PAN1080 | Ling Bao custom 8K chip |
| Sensor | PAW3311 | PAW3395 | PAW3395 | PAW3395 |
| Key Life | 50 million times | 80 million times | Huanyu 0.1 billion times | OMRON 0.1 billion times light micro movement |
| Rate of Return (Polling Rate) | Wired 1K + Wireless 1K | Wired 1K + Wireless 1K | Wired 1K + Wireless 8K | Wired 8K Wireless 8K |
| Drive | Client driver | Client driver | Support dual driver (client driver/web driver) | Support dual driver (client driver/web driver) |
| DPI | 800-12000 (six-speed adjustable) | 400-26000 (six-speed adjustable) | 400-26000 (six-speed adjustable) | 1200-26000 (six-speed adjustable) |
| Mouse Weight | ~65g | 67.4g (product color dependent) | 67.4g (product color dependent) | 67.4g (product color dependent) |
| Battery Capacity | 400mAh | 400mAh | 400mAh | 400mAh |
| Connection Mode | Three-mode connection: 2.4G/wired/Bluetooth | |||
| Mouse Size | 122.5 x 65.5 x 42.7 mm | |||
